Linux系列(37) - 源码包与RPM包区别(1)

时间:2024-01-18 20:24:44
  • 源码包是不能使用【service】命令来启动服务,因为源码包的安装位置由用户指定
  • 源码包一般安装在: /usr/local/软件名/ ,源码包安装的服务,只能用绝对路径进行服务的管理
  • rpm包安装后,通常都是放在【/etc/rc.d/init.d】目录中的,而【service】命令执行时,会自动搜索该目录,所以rpm包安装的服务可以使用【service】命令
  • 使用绝对路径启动程序的方法是通用的,通常软件包中会写上启动程序的方法的
  • 如果将源码包安装后的启动程序复制到【/etc/rc.d/init.d】目录中,则也是可以使用【service】命令执行的